TechTorch

Location:HOME > Technology > content

Technology

SAP HANA in Real-time Analytics: Enhancing Business Competitiveness and Decision-Making

May 25, 2025Technology4980
SAP HANA in Real-time Analytics: Enhancing Business Competitiveness an

SAP HANA in Real-time Analytics: Enhancing Business Competitiveness and Decision-Making

SAP HANA plays a crucial role in supporting real-time analytics, providing businesses with a high-performance in-memory database platform that enables instant access to vast amounts of data. By leveraging SAP HANA, companies can make swift and informed decisions, ensuring their competitiveness in today's fast-paced business environment.

How SAP HANA Supports Real-time Analytics

With its unique capabilities, SAP HANA significantly enhances real-time analytics by supporting high-speed data processing, seamless data integration, and advanced analytics. These features ensure that businesses can derive meaningful insights from their data in real time, driving better decision-making and operational efficiency.

In-Memory Computing and Data Processing

In-Memory Computing involves storing data in RAM rather than on disk. This approach dramatically improves data retrieval and processing speeds, crucial for real-time analytics where insights need to be generated instantly based on live data.

Fast Data Processing: SAP HANA stores data in memory, reducing the time it takes to retrieve and process information, which is essential for real-time analytics. Reduced Latency: By eliminating the need to read data from disk storage, SAP HANA minimizes latency, allowing organizations to perform complex queries and calculations on large datasets in real time.

Real-time Data Integration with ETL Processes

Real-time data integration is facilitated by SAP HANA through its support for ETL (Extract, Transform, Load) processes. This ensures that data from various sources can be continuously integrated, transformed, and loaded into the HANA database as it is generated, providing real-time analytics based on the most current data available.

Data Streaming: SAP HANA integrates with SAP Data Services and SAP Smart Data Integration to stream real-time data from multiple sources, including IoT devices, transactional systems, and external databases, enabling real-time analytics on streaming data.

Advanced Analytics Capabilities

SAP HANA’s powerful in-memory processing capabilities support complex analytical queries, including predictive analytics, machine learning algorithms, and text analysis in real time. This advanced functionality supports various use cases such as fraud detection, demand forecasting, and customer behavior analysis.

Real-time Reporting: SAP HANA enables real-time reporting by providing instantaneous access to up-to-date data, allowing users to generate and view reports with the latest information and make timely decisions.

Data Compression and Storage Efficiency

Efficient data management is crucial for real-time analytics. SAP HANA uses columnar storage to optimize the database for analytical queries by storing data in columns rather than rows, allowing for better compression and faster retrieval of data needed for analytics.

Efficient Memory Usage: The combination of in-memory storage and data compression techniques makes SAP HANA capable of handling large datasets efficiently, enabling real-time analytics on big data.

Support for Mixed Workloads

SAP HANA supports OLAP (Online Analytical Processing) and OLTP (Online Transactional Processing) on a single platform. This means businesses can perform real-time analytics directly on transactional data without moving it to a separate data warehouse, ensuring seamless integration and performance.

Hybrid Transactional/Analytical Processing (HTAP): By supporting HTAP, SAP HANA enables businesses to run analytics on live transactional data, providing immediate insights into ongoing operations.

Scalability and Performance

SAP HANA is designed for scalability and performance through its capabilities to handle large volumes of data and complex workloads:

Horizontal and Vertical Scaling: SAP HANA can scale horizontally by adding more nodes or vertically by adding more memory and processing power, ensuring the system can handle growing data volumes and increasing analytical workloads without compromising performance. Distributed Computing: SAP HANA supports distributed computing across multiple nodes, allowing for parallel data processing and further enhancing the speed of real-time analytics.

Integration with SAP Ecosystem

Seamless Integration: SAP HANA integrates seamlessly with other SAP solutions, such as SAP S/4HANA, SAP BusinessObjects, and SAP BW/4HANA, ensuring a cohesive and efficient analytical environment. This integration enables real-time analytics across various business functions, from finance and supply chain to sales and marketing.

SAP Analytics Cloud: SAP HANA integrates with SAP Analytics Cloud, providing users with advanced analytics and visualization tools directly on top of the HANA database. This integration offers a user-friendly, real-time analytics environment.

Real-time Dashboards and Visualization

Live Data Visualizations: With SAP HANA, businesses can create real-time dashboards and visualizations that reflect the current state of operations. These dashboards allow decision-makers to monitor key performance indicators (KPIs) and metrics in real time, facilitating quicker and more informed decisions.

Embedded Analytics: SAP HANA's embedded analytics capabilities enable real-time insights into business applications, allowing users to interact with data and make decisions within their day-to-day workflows.

Real-time Predictive and Prescriptive Analytics

Predictive Analytics: SAP HANA integrates with SAP Predictive Analytics, allowing businesses to run predictive models on real-time data and gain insights into future trends and outcomes based on current conditions.

Prescriptive Analytics: Using SAP HANA's speed and integration capabilities, businesses can perform prescriptive analytics, recommending actions based on real-time data and predictive insights, enhancing operational efficiency and strategic decision-making.

AI and Machine Learning Integration

Embedded Machine Learning: SAP HANA includes built-in machine learning capabilities, allowing businesses to apply AI algorithms directly to their data in real time. This supports use cases such as anomaly detection, predictive maintenance, and personalized customer recommendations.

SAP Data Intelligence: SAP HANA integrates with SAP Data Intelligence to manage and orchestrate AI and machine learning workflows, further enhancing the ability to perform real-time analytics with embedded AI.

Conclusion

SAP HANA’s in-memory architecture, real-time data processing, and advanced analytics capabilities make it a powerful platform for supporting real-time analytics. By enabling instant access to current data, reducing latency, and integrating with various SAP and non-SAP systems, SAP HANA allows businesses to gain immediate insights, make data-driven decisions, and stay competitive in fast-paced environments. SAP HANA is a critical enabler of real-time business intelligence for operational reporting, predictive analytics, and complex data analysis.